The MVP Playbook
This ebook helps your customers transform business ideas into validated products by focusing on building a Minimum Viable Product (MVP) that delivers real customer value with minimal risk. It provides practical guidance on identifying essential features, testing assumptions with real users, and using feedback to refine and improve the product over time. Through proven frameworks and actionable strategies, readers will learn how to launch faster, reduce unnecessary development costs, and make data-driven decisions that increase the likelihood of long-term success.
